Fundamental Contractual Elements in Endorsement Deals

Fundamental contractual elements in endorsement deals typically include clear delineation of the scope of services, compensation structure, and duration of the agreement. These components establish mutual understanding and legal clarity between the athlete and the endorsing company.

The scope of services specifies the athlete’s obligations, such as appearances, social media promotion, or product endorsements. Precisely defining these obligations helps prevent disputes and ensures compliance with contractual terms.

Compensation details encompass payment amounts, payment schedules, and any performance-based incentives. Including these specifics safeguards both parties’ interests and clarifies expectations. Discrepancies in compensation are common sources of legal conflicts in endorsement agreements.

The duration of the endorsement deal sets the timeframe for the athlete’s commitments and rights to use the brand’s intellectual property. Clearly stating the contract length and renewal conditions is essential for legal enforceability and future planning.

Truth-in-Advertising Laws and Disclosures

In the context of athlete endorsement deals, adherence to truth-in-advertising laws ensures transparency between athletes, endorsers, and consumers. These laws require that any claims made about products or services be truthful, not misleading, and substantiated by evidence. Athletes must disclose any material connections to brands, such as sponsorship agreements, to avoid deceptive practices.

Disclosures are essential when athletes promote products that may influence consumer decisions. For example, when endorsing dietary supplements or skincare products, transparency about compensation or sponsorships avoids false impressions. Failure to disclose such relationships can lead to legal penalties and reputational damage.

Regulatory agencies such as the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) in the United States enforce these laws. They mandate clear, conspicuous disclosures to prevent misleading advertising. Endorsement deals must align with these standards to mitigate legal risks and maintain ethical integrity. Consistent compliance safeguards the athlete’s reputation and ensures legal adherence in the evolving sports marketing landscape.

Dispute Resolution and Enforcement Mechanisms

Dispute resolution and enforcement mechanisms serve as vital components in ensuring the enforceability of athlete endorsement deals and resolving conflicts efficiently. These mechanisms provide clarity on how disputes will be handled, minimizing legal uncertainties. Courts are often involved, but arbitration is frequently preferred for its confidentiality, speed, and expertise in sports law.

When drafting endorsement agreements, parties should specify the dispute resolution process clearly. This may include the choice of arbitration institutions, such as the International Chamber of Commerce or the American Arbitration Association. It is also advisable to define the governing law and jurisdiction for enforceability purposes.

Enforcement mechanisms may involve court actions to uphold arbitration awards or to seek injunctive relief or damages. Properly structured dispute resolution clauses help mitigate risks, protect reputations, and ensure compliance with legal obligations. Setting clear procedures into the agreement offers a practical approach to managing future disagreements effectively.

Compliance with Anti-Corruption Policies

Adhering to anti-corruption policies is fundamental in athlete endorsement deals to ensure integrity within sports and advertising sectors. These policies typically prohibit bribery, kickbacks, or any illicit inducements aimed at influencing decision-making processes. Athletes and endorsers must be vigilant to avoid scenarios that could be perceived as corrupt practices, which can lead to severe legal and reputational consequences.

Governing bodies and sports organizations often impose strict guidelines that endorse transparency and ethical conduct during contract negotiations and endorsement activities. Compliance with these policies involves thorough due diligence, clear contractual provisions, and ongoing monitoring to prevent violations. Failure to adhere may result in sanctions, contract termination, or legal action, underscoring the importance of proactive compliance measures.

Furthermore, anti-corruption policies often align with international standards and anti-bribery laws, such as the UK’s Bribery Act or the Foreign Corrupt Practices Act in the United States. Understanding and implementing these standards help athletes and organizations mitigate legal risks, maintain compliance, and uphold fair play principles essential to sports law.

Case Studies of Notable Legal Issues in Athlete Endorsements

Several high-profile legal issues in athlete endorsement deals have set important precedents and highlighted potential risks. Notable cases include Tiger Woods’ 2009 scandal, which led to the termination of multiple endorsement agreements due to personal conduct violations. This case illustrates how an athlete’s personal actions can directly impact legal obligations and contractual relationships.

Another illustrative example involves the controversy surrounding Lance Armstrong. His doping scandal resulted in the revocation of sponsorships and legal disputes over breach of contract. This case underscores the importance of compliance with doping regulations and anti-doping policies, which are critical components of legal risk management in endorsement agreements.

Additionally, legal disputes involving Nike and Colin Kaepernick in 2019 demonstrated the complexities surrounding endorsement deals linked to social and political activism. These cases reveal how endorsements can become entangled in broader legal and ethical considerations, potentially leading to disputes over rights, messages, and brand reputation.

These case studies serve as valuable lessons in the importance of clear contractual clauses, compliance with regulations, and safeguarding brand integrity within the context of the legal implications of athlete endorsement deals.
